Impact-chamber grain mills like the Nutrimill and Wonder Mill are best for grinding fine grades of flour but have less grinding range than burr grain mill models like the Country Living Grain Mill. The latter can't grind grains as finely as impact-chamber grain mills, but they can grind much more coarsely for producing cereals and cracked wheat.

Likewise, Nutrimill manufactures the grinding chamber of the mills with plastic materials. This is also mostly done by Komo, Hawos or Schnitzer. Mills like Nutrimill, Komo or Hawos or Schnitzer use the artificial grinding stone of corundum ceramics. The corundum used is not of natural origin, it is aluminiumoxid with the chemical formula AL203.

Electric grain mills are easier and quicker to operate, though they consume electricity. Manual grain mills save you the cost of electricity but require you to put in the physical effort to grind the grains yourself and can be much slower to produce the same yield of ground grains as their electric counterpart.
